Exploring Jamesport, New York
Jamesport, New York, known for its picturesque vineyards and charming rural landscapes, offers a serene escape from the bustling city life. With historical landmarks like the Jamesport Meeting House and the Hallockville Museum Farm, this quaint town is rich in culture and heritage. Visitors can enjoy fresh produce from local farms or indulge in wine tasting at the numerous vineyards scattered across the region.
